Congratulations. I know by experience that it's hard to quit. Seems the harder I tried the more I smoked. Then somehow I quit caring about tobacco. One day I told myself, "It's three weeks since I had a smoke." I counted the days the best I could recall, to be certain. "I guess I quit smoking," I said, and I've never bought another tobacco product for about ten years. In fact, tobacco now disgusts me. I hope, mightily, that one day you will have the same feeling. Rae: I quit cold turkey quite a few years ago. I decided that I didn't want to be controlled by any habit. I just approached the probem with a positive attitude. I fought the cravings when they occurred, and won every time. They lasted about a week and diminished daily for about three weeks and disappeared. I have never been tempted since. If it is important enough to you, you can do it. Good luck.
